Here’s how you can watch the Samsung Galaxy Note9 launch

If you are one of the Galaxy lovers out there, tonight is the night that you are going to witness the highly anticipated launch of the Samsung Galaxy Note9.

In just a few more hours, you can catch Samsung Galaxy Unpacked 2018 live today (August 9) by tuning in at 11pm (Malaysia time) via their official website or you can go to their Facebook page when the event begins..

For what we’ve know, the Samsung Galaxy Note9 is expected to have 8GB of RAM and a storage up to 512GB. The internal storage can be further upgraded to 1TB via a 512 microSD. Samsung has also decided to equip the Note9 with a 4,000 mAh battery. What else would you like to see?
